Denny Hamlin won his third race of the 2020 season Sunday night at Homestead. Hamlin started first and was near the front for most of the race. He was the only driver who led over 100 laps in the 267-lap race and was able to prevent Chase Elliott from challenging him.

Sunday’s race at Homestead was originally scheduled for 3:30 p.m. ET; however it was delayed multiple times by rain and lightning and finally finished at approximately 10:45 p.m. ET.

Hamlin won his third race of the season, and his second since NASCAR resumed racing after their postponement due to the coronavirus pandemic. Hamlin won the season-opening Daytona 500 and then won at Darlington on May 20. Hamlin is also the first driver to three wins in the Cup Series in 2020.
